Understanding Semaglutide and Its Mechanism

Semaglutide, marketed under brand names like Ozempic (for diabetes) and Wegovy (for weight loss), mimics the action of the natural incretin hormone gl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1). This hormone plays a crucial role in regulating blood sugar and appetite. By stimulating insulin release, suppressing glucagon secretion, slowing gastric emptying, and reducing appetite, semaglutide effectively lowers blood glucose levels and aids in weight management.Risks of taking GLP-1 medicines. Common Gastrointestinal Effects

The most frequently reported side effects of semaglutide are gastrointestinal effects. These are largely attributed to the drug's effect on gastric emptying. Common issues include:

* Vomiting: The forceful expulsion of stomach contents.

* Constipation: Difficulty passing stools.

* Abdominal pain: Discomfort in the stomach area.

* Burping: The expulsion of gas from the stomach through the mouth.

* Gallbladder Issues: Rapid weight loss, often facilitated by semaglutide, can increase the risk of gallbladder problems, such as gallstones.

* Hypoglycemia (Low Blood Sugar): While semaglutide generally helps lower blood sugar, the risk of low blood sugar can increase, particularly when used in conjunction with other diabetes medications like insulin or sulfonylureas. Symptoms of hypoglycemia include shakiness, sweating, confusion, and rapid heartbeat. * Electrolyte Disturbances: Severe vomiting and diarrhea can lead to electrolyte disturbances, imbalances of minerals in the body that are crucial for normal function.

* Reduced Muscle Functioning: Some studies have indicated a potential for reduced muscle functioning as a consequence of the weight loss associated with semaglutide.

Contraindications and Important Safety Information

Due to these potential risks, certain individuals should not take semaglutide. These include those with a personal or family history of medullary thyroid carcinoma or MEN 2.
